directions

Preheat your oven to 325°F (165°C) and line a baking sheet with parchment paper.

In a mixing bowl, combine the shredded coconut, chocolate chips, and chopped almonds.

Add the sweetened condensed milk, vanilla extract, and a pinch of salt. Stir until fully combined.

Using a cookie scoop or spoon, form small mounds of the mixture and place them on the prepared baking sheet.

Gently press each cookie to slightly flatten.

Bake for 12–14 minutes, or until the edges are golden brown.

Let the cookies cool on the baking sheet for 5 minutes, then transfer to a wire rack to cool completely.

Variations

Use dark chocolate chips for a richer flavor.

Swap almonds for pecans or walnuts if preferred.

Drizzle melted chocolate on top after baking for an extra indulgent touch.

Add a sprinkle of sea salt on top before baking for a sweet-salty combo.

storage/reheating

Store in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 5 days.Refrigerate for up to 10 days for longer freshness.They can be frozen for up to 2 months—thaw at room temperature before enjoying.No reheating is necessary, but you can warm briefly in the microwave for a softer texture.

FAQs

Can I double this recipe?

Yes, just double each ingredient to make a larger batch.

Can I use unsweetened coconut?

Yes, but the cookies will be less sweet—adjust the amount of sweetened condensed milk if needed.

Do I need to toast the almonds?

Toasting enhances their flavor, but it’s optional.

Can I make these without nuts?

Absolutely, just leave out the almonds for a nut-free version.

Are these cookies gluten-free?

Yes, all ingredients used are naturally gluten-free, but always check labels to be sure.

Why did my cookies spread too much?

Overmixing or using too much condensed milk can cause spreading—stick to the recommended measurements.

Can I make these vegan?

Use a vegan sweetened condensed milk and dairy-free chocolate chips.

Do these cookies travel well?

Yes, they hold their shape and texture, making them great for lunchboxes or gifting.

Description

Small Batch Almond Joy Cookies are soft, chewy cookies packed with chocolate chips, shredded coconut, and almonds, inspired by the classic candy bar.


Ingredients

Units Scale
  • 1/4 cup unsalted butter, softened
  • 1/4 cup brown sugar
  • 2 tbsp granulated sugar
  • 1/2 tsp vanilla extract
  • 1 large egg yolk
  • 1/2 cup all-purpose flour
  • 1/4 tsp baking soda
  • 1/8 tsp salt
  • 1/4 cup shredded sweetened coconut
  • 1/4 cup semi-sweet chocolate chips
  • 2 tbsp chopped almonds

Instructions

  1. Preheat the oven to 350°F (175°C) and line a baking sheet with parchment paper.
  2. In a bowl, cream together the butter, brown sugar, and granulated sugar until light and fluffy.
  3. Mix in the vanilla extract and egg yolk until well combined.
  4. In a separate bowl, whisk together the flour, baking soda, and salt.
  5. Gradually add the dry ingredients to the wet ingredients and mix until just combined.
  6. Fold in the coconut, chocolate chips, and chopped almonds.
  7. Drop spoonfuls of dough onto the prepared baking sheet, spacing them about 2 inches apart.
  8. Bake for 9-11 minutes or until the edges are golden and the centers are set.
  9. Allow cookies to cool on the baking sheet for 5 minutes before transferring to a wire rack to cool completely.

Notes

  • You can toast the almonds beforehand for extra flavor.
  • These cookies are best enjoyed within 2-3 days of baking.
  • Store in an airtight container at room temperature.
